Job Description:
Description Summary: Assists in the examination, treatment and
care of patients. Also, responsible for phones, appointments,
obtaining insurance authorizations for test/surgeries, medical
record preparation. Associate is also responsible for assisting the
supervising physician or nurse as needed; and assisting with
surgical procedures and with admitting and screening patients.
